Which Craft is Right for Me?
Diana discovered the enjoyment of pottery after suffering a terrible divorce. Taking a seat at the wheel with a lump of clay, she felt an instantaneous release. Her mind cleared and her heart rate slowed down. She was in a position to relax in a means she hadn't for weeks. "Higher than therapy-and medication!" she happily reported to her doctor once her initial day at a community education class, where she went on to form friends with fellow potters, additional enriching her life.
For Kris it had been counted cross-stitch. The repetitive motion of the needle passing up and down through crisp cloth put her in an exceedingly near-meditative state, the manner yoga will for some. In this state Kris was in a position to work out solutions to her daily challenges. "It absolutely was just like the ideas dropped into my mind out of the sky," she told a close friend.
Shawn found furniture restoration to be wonderfully soothing after a stressful day at the office. The raw scent of wood loosened him up, and he was stunned how satisfying it absolutely was to sit down at a table he had restored himself.
Such is the world of DIY. Discovering the right craft for your personality and temperament will be a bequest that transforms your life.
The crafting world is as wide and diverse as a tropical rainforest. Each crafting activity has distinctive advantages and challenges. You'll pay your entire life simply attempting out totally different crafts. Whereas this may be fun, it will be expensive and frustrating. Should you need to slender your search down, this article will act as your guide by investigating the globe of crafts as they work into five spectrums. If one activity does not suit you, take heart. Crafting is for everyone-you're certain to find that excellent match.
1. Short-term comes vs. long-term projects.
Do you have a would like for immediate gratification? If you do, you would possibly like cake decorating, ceramics, candle-creating, lotions-n-potions, or cut-n-paste projects (scrapbooking, collage, and decoupage), which deliver results relatively quickly. Conversely, if you are known to possess the patience of Job, needlecrafts and quilting may be your thing. (Though quilting by machine cuts down the time dramatically). If you prefer long-term comes, pottery and gardening are wonderful choices, since they involve several steps.
2. Fastidiousness vs. playfulness/ looseness
Needlecrafts, baking, and jewelry-creating need a meticulous and careful eye, whereas cooking, gardening and cut-n-paste projects are more appropriate for the playful type. Keep in mind that a lot of activities can go either way or are best for people who can balance a bit of each quality.
3. Planner by nature vs. spontaneous to the core
If you do not mind doing a very little math, counted cross-stitch, knitting, and crochet are great activities. Needlecrafts, quilting and sewing also require planning and pattern-reading. If all this sounds too boring or frustrating and you like to jump headlong into projects as soon as you're feeling an urge, cut-n-paste, candle-making, ceramics, or pottery could be a higher fit.
4. Area offered
Does one affectionately decision your apartment a cabinet? If you need an activity that takes up very little space or can be cleaned up in a very jiffy, yarn and needlecrafts can be tucked away during a basket or a drawer. Baking and cake decorating use what you almost certainly already have in your kitchen, and jewelry solely desires a modest tackle-box with very little compartments for beads and tools. But maybe you've got a area or an entire basement where a hobby may take up a permanent residence? Pottery is such a hobby. If you quilt by hand you will want a area where a reasonably large frame can be set up (unless you simply wish to try to to baby quilts). A table for laying out and cutting patterns is needed for stitching, and most individuals do not appreciate having to lug out the machine each time you want to work on a project. (However, it can be done.) Lotions-n-potions, and candle and soap making can be done within the kitchen so long as precautions are taken, however ideally they have a separate space, since you are using dangerous chemicals that you do not wish to accidentally mix with food. Gardening is ideal if you've got a pleasant-sized yard, but several green-thumbed apartment dwellers find cultivating the area around their windows, on their patio, or even potted indoor plants a satisfying diversion. Do not lose heart if you do not have house for an activity that interests you-simply sign on for a community category!
5. Available funds for expenses
Each craft has a range of what you may buy the activity, depending on your taste and willingness. If you're picky concerning using solely hand-dyed, organically grown 100% wool yarn, you're going to pay a lot more than someone who works with an acrylic yarn obtainable at the closest Woolworth's. It's a good idea when simply starting out to borrow someone else's equipment, or use inexpensive provides till you know it's an activity you are going to stick with. Then you can slowly replace your provides with quality items that you simply appreciate. On average, pottery and stitching require additional expensive equipment to begin, while you'll be able to garden, cross-stitch, or cut-n-paste on a shoestring budget. Yarn crafts are the cheapest activities to attempt, since they do not require a ton of pricy equipment to start. Once more, a class would possibly be the best investment for the more expensive hobbies.
If you still aren't positive that craft is right for you, speak to alternative crafters about why they enjoy their craft. Raise if you'll be able to join them in the future to work out if it is one thing that appeals to you. Wait with yourself as you begin every new activity--nothing kills the thrill of making an attempt something new a lot of than impossibly high expectations. Don't worry--as you continue, your skills will improve. You will additionally know higher which activities suit you best.
